No axle issues. The shift cable cover is slightly different. It's mentioned in other threads to get the cover with the replacement trans...I didn't and just bought a new one from Honda dealer (about $30). I made my CL one work for a couple days but, it really doesn't fit right. After installing new cover, I adjusted my cable slightly. You remove the panel on the passenger side along the shifter inside car. There is a nut you'll see holding the cable. The end of the cable has a slotted fitting. Loosen the nut and make any adjustment necessary. I don't think I swapped the range switch, just one connector with wires attached that was different (and cooler/filter assembly). Got my swap done. 06 Oddy Trans in my 01 CL-s. Everything went great. I'm prolly gonna get the oe shift cable cover for the oddy trans. Shift selector is just a touch off. I also swapped the dipstick and jet kit over along with range switch, filter, and heat exchanger assy. Used trans is quiet and works great. Hopin for alot over trouble free life left.
OK guys so i finish the swap and thank god everything went well. As eric5582 mentioned I also swapped the dipstick and jet kit over along with range switch, filter, and heat exchanger assembly. Here are a few pics i took and outlined for the guys like me who don't know much about these newer cars.

The GREEN outline point to the range switch, after removing i noticed the wires were same colors and plug same design. however the parts outline in RED definitely needs swapping, that harness uses about 3 plugs vs the CLS 1 giant plug.

Photo above shows the oil jet assembly and the fill plug.

When swapping the filter assembly you also need this line along with the fill plug.

Once you remove the top part of the oil jet kit,remove the filter assembly in photo above.

This is the Odyssey tranny with oil jet kit, filter assembly, range switch all swapped over.
Also make sure you get the cover for the shift linkage from your oddy trans because the CL/TL will not fit properly and will cause your shifter to be off. If your like me and did not get the cover with your tranny try calling them and ask if you can get one or buy one from honda at $30 (part # 24901-RGL-000)

My Oddy trans (2006) was a little different due to the external type cooler set up. Here are some photos with notations. Someone mentioned the speed sensors were different so, I changed mine over and pointed them out in a pic. The speed sensors look a little different when removed but, I did not check to see if the connector part is different. Jaber18 did not mention these so maybe they don't need to be swapped. "As eric5582 mentioned I also swapped the dipstick"
I don't want any credit but, I mentioned this too. NOTE: As I also mentioned, the fill marks are a little off when putting the two dipsticks side by side (at least on my swap). If I was to go off the CL dipstick marks, the fluid level would be a little low. I made marks on my dipstick based off the Oddy dipstick along side.

drn33 I did not need to swap the speed sensors, my plugs were the same. the small harness next to the range switch did need to be swapped in my tranny because the Ody used 3 plugs vs cl 1 plug
